Common Craftsman Garage Door Problems We Solve in Cudahy
- Motor burnout on Craftsman 1/2 HP Series 100 openers. These units—model 139.53985 and similar—were never designed for the undersized electrical runs common in Cudahy’s converted garages. When a former bedroom has one 15-amp circuit running lights, outlets, and a garage opener, the motor overheats and fails prematurely. We diagnose the power supply first, not just swap the opener.
- Torsion spring corrosion on single-car steel doors. Cudahy’s inland position exposes it to stronger Santa Ana wind events than coastal LA. Those winds drive dust and moisture past worn weather seals, then morning marine-layer humidity cycles the metal through wet and dry. Original Craftsman springs last 5–7 years here, not the 8–10 you’d see in milder climates. We spec heavy-duty 10,000-cycle aftermarket springs that outlast OEM.
- Safety sensor misalignment from conversion-related framing shifts. In Cudahy’s informally converted garages, header beams get notched, walls get moved, and floors get raised. The Craftsman photo-eye system—precisely aligned at installation—now points at a stud or sits an inch too high. The door reverses randomly or won’t close. We realign to current structure, not original specs that no longer exist.
- Wall console signal drop in densely packed lots. Craftsman wall consoles on 139.53970 chain-drive and 139.53990 belt-drive units can lose connection when neighboring homes’ electrical systems create interference. On Cudahy’s narrow 25-foot lots, that interference is constant. We troubleshoot wiring runs and shielding before declaring the console dead.
- Track failure after conversion reversal. When Cudahy property owners reverse a non-permitted bedroom conversion to restore garage function, they often discover tracks were torn out, brackets removed, or the opening framed down. We rebuild with low-headroom track kits for 7-foot openings and verify header load capacity before hanging any Craftsman door.
Craftsman Service in Cudahy: What Local Conditions Mean for Your Equipment
Cudahy’s 1-square-mile density means most garages have zero setback from the property line. There’s no side yard to stage a door replacement. No driveway to stack panels. For any full Craftsman door installation on Cudahy’s narrow lots, we’re working from the sidewalk or the street—which means a traffic control plan filed with the Cudahy Police Department, cones, and often a second trip to coordinate timing. We’ve done this enough to know which streets on Clara Street and the surrounding blocks allow morning staging versus afternoon. It’s not a complication we complain about; it’s the reality of working in a city where every inch counts. Your technician either accounts for it or wastes your Saturday figuring it out.
This density also explains why so many Cudahy Craftsman openers we service are the wrong unit for the space. A 3/4 HP belt drive crammed into a converted garage with 6.5 feet of headroom, the rail cut down with a hacksaw. A chain drive rattling against a bedroom wall because nobody installed isolation mounts. We fix the installation, not just the symptom.
Craftsman Models & Products We Service in Cudahy
We carry OEM-compatible parts for the Craftsman lines most common in Cudahy’s postwar housing stock: the 1/2 HP Series 100 (model 139.53985 and similar), the 3/4 HP Belt Drive (model 139.53990 and similar), and the 1/2 HP Chain Drive (model 139.53970 and similar). For opener repairs and safety sensors, we use genuine Craftsman OEM components—no universal remotes that lose programming in six months. For springs and cables, we upgrade to heavy-duty 10,000-cycle aftermarket torsion hardware that handles Cudahy’s corrosion cycle better than original equipment.
Our Santa Monica-based inventory covers circuit boards, drive gears, rail segments, and photo-eye kits for same-day Cudahy turnaround. If your Craftsman unit needs replacement, we only recommend it when repair costs exceed 60% of a new opener—otherwise, we fix what’s there.
